Output 103feb80309e18b61cdfdb82b04354190bca1a67014ed70b88812735e654c88b:0

value
6981879785243
script pubkey
OP_0 OP_PUSHBYTES_20 dd6273527595b1315487ee1e66dd4beab6c08245
address
tb1qm438x5n4jkcnz4y8ac0xdh2ta2mvpqj9fjdy9g
transaction
103feb80309e18b61cdfdb82b04354190bca1a67014ed70b88812735e654c88b
spent
true